imageQUETTA: According to unofficial results, the major winners of the first phase of Balochistan By-Local Government elections remained Pakistan Muslim League-N, Pashtoonkhawa Milli Awami Party and Jamiat Ulema-e-Islam-Fazl.

When contacted, official sources in the Provincial Election Commission Balochistan told APP, here on Monday that they would announce the final and official results of the by-Local bodies elections on January 21 or within next two or three days. They, however, confirmed that the PML-N, PkMAP and JUI-F were among the major winners of the by-elections.

"PkMAP won several seats in Harnai district and JUI-F in other districts of Pashtoon belt while PML-N clinched seats in east Balochistan districts of Jaffarabad and Sibi," they said.

The Provincial Election Commissioner Balochistan, Syed Sultan Bayazeed said that they would issue the schedule for oath taking of newly elected councilors after the official results of the by-polls.

"The by-LG polls were conducted without reporting of any untoward incident and voters thronged the polling stations to cast their votes," he said.

The by-LB polls were held for 98 seats in 12 districts of Balochistan including of district councils, municipal committees and union councils. The by-LG elections for reaming 331 vacant seats would be held in second phase as these could not be conducted for them on January 19 due to law and order situation and other reasons.

"The most population of Awaran district was displaced from their native areas after deadly earthquake devastated the district, causing life and property loss," they said, adding therefore, the by-LG elections could not be held in the district in first phase on January 19," the officials said.
